Who uses CFIUSCheck
CFIUS Counsel

Jurisdictional triage at intake

Determine at intake whether a real estate transaction warrants voluntary Part 802 analysis. Replace manual lookups with a verified, timestamped primary-source report suitable for client files and regulatory submissions.

M&A Attorney

Foreign agricultural acquisition screening

Screen target parcels during due diligence for CFIUS and USDA AFIDA reporting obligations before closing. Identify ICBM field county exposure that standard title review misses.

Real Estate Counsel

Foreign buyer transaction support

Advise foreign national and foreign entity buyers on CFIUS proximity implications before contract execution. Generate documentation for the file and provide a defensible basis for your advice.

Compliance Officers

Portfolio monitoring

Run proximity analysis across existing foreign-owned agricultural portfolios following Appendix A expansions. The December 2024 update changed coverage for installations in multiple states — the regime history analysis shows which parcels were affected.
